Musical: Wizard Of Oz, The
Song: Poppies
Poppy Flowers:
We are poppies
In fairest splendor
Blooming fragrant always
Through the mosses and
The grasses looming
Fascinations rare assuming.
We delight when alone to pass
The moments gaily at play
Every petal graciously nods
Our many charms to display.
Poppy Queen:
For death like a breath,
Comes to all soon or late
And mortals are the sport
Of a mischievous fate.
So welcome the peace
That we bring to mankind
It is happiness to dream on,
With every care left behind.
Poppy Flowers:
We are poppies
In fairest splendor
Blooming fragrant always
Through the mosses and
The grasses looming
Fascinations rare assuming.
We delight when alone to pass
The moments gaily at play
Every petal graciously nods
Our many charms to display,
Our charms to display,
Our charms to display.
